## Break-Glass Access: Corvette Broker Upgrade

During the Hollis-to-Pinnacle broker migration, normal admin credentials are rotated nightly and may lag the upgrade window. If the Marbleton cluster refuses standard logins mid-upgrade, use the break-glass console account. Document every use in the sync notes. Authentication requires the emergency recovery passphrase, which is recorded immediately below.

unlock words, tawif-tahop: oliys-ulawyn-tamdor-lamys-casox-jormir-fraius-kasath-ulador-ulamir-holir-sorys-holeth

### Step 7: Waveform Preview Service

The Chorrick waveform renderer generates preview images for uploaded audio so support can verify files without downloading them. Deploy the `wavesketch` container alongside the main app and point it at the Fennmark media bucket. Previews render asynchronously; expect up to thirty seconds for long files. The renderer needs bucket credentials, so add this line to its environment file:

sealed setting: ARCHIVE_KEY3=8d0

**Handover Note — Project Larkspur**

Morning all — passing the baton to Delia as I move to the Westholt office. Larkspur is running about six weeks behind, mostly down to the vendor integration mess. Branch managers, keep expectations modest until the revised schedule lands. Delia has the full picture. One sensitive item on forward plans is noted just below.

internal memo for kawip-hadug: Headcount on the Wenwyn team goes from 7 to 140 by the end of January. Gross margin on Wenwyn came in at 20 percent against a plan of 15 percent.

Ticket #88: Badge system migration, night-shift notice. Over the weekend, Fenwick Row is moving from the old Keystone readers to the new Ardale panels. Night staff should expect the lift lobby readers to be offline between 01:00 and 04:00 on Saturday. During this window, use the stairwell doors only, and log every entry in the paper register at the guard desk. Legacy badges will stop working once the cutover completes. Until your replacement badge arrives, the night crew should use the interim code below.

door code, yageg-yagap: bdg-DNN-9